On Wednesday, April 9, 2014, at 3:00 PM in Room 510, we will spotlight the issues raised by Hobby Lobby’s challenge of the Affordable Care Act’s contraceptive mandate by hosting a moot between two Chicago-Kent heavyweights of appellate advocacy.

Arguing the position of the U.S. government will be Dean Harold Krent, our school’s fearless leader who has argued before the U.S. Supreme Court.

Arguing the position of Hobby Lobby will be Professor Kent Streseman, the director of Chicago-Kent’s Appellate Advocacy Program.
